Analog Switches, Multiplexers, Demultiplexers Analog Devices, Inc. ADG436BRZ Overview
The Analog Devices, Inc. ADG436BRZ is a high-performance, dual-channel SPDT (Single Pole Double Throw) switch, designed for precision and reliability in integrated circuits applications. This device, encased in a compact 16SOIC package, excels in offering low on-resistance and fast switching speeds, making it a prime choice for a variety of demanding applications. The Analog Switches, Multiplexers, Demultiplexers Analog Devices, Inc. ADG436BRZ stands out for its robust design, featuring latch-up immunity and ESD (Electrostatic Discharge) protection which enhances its durability and reliability in complex electronic systems.
ADG436BRZ Features
The ADG436BRZ includes several key features that make it particularly useful for sophisticated electronic switching needs:
- Low on-resistance, minimizing power loss and improving signal integrity.
- High switching speed, facilitating quicker response times in critical applications.
- Dual SPDT configuration, allowing for flexible signal routing in a single package.
- Extended operating temperature range, ensuring performance stability in extreme conditions.
- ESD protection and latch-up immunity, providing robustness against environmental and handling hazards.
ADG436BRZ Applications
- Communication Systems: Utilized in signal routing to optimize the integration and performance of communication infrastructure.
- Data Acquisition Systems: Plays a critical role in switching between input signals, ensuring accurate data capture and processing.
- Audio and Video Equipment: Facilitates the distribution of audio and video signals, enhancing multimedia setups.
- Test Equipment: Essential in the configuration of test setups, allowing for precise control and variability of signal paths.
- Medical Devices: Applied in patient monitoring equipment to manage multiple sensor inputs efficiently and reliably.
